    PeakOwl wrote: »
    am I right in thinking I can top-up the initial payment with another £750 this month (and is it acceptable to do that by 'Faster Payments' from my linked account?) .

    A minor note, as this is unclear - if you use the "pull money" feature from the newcastle BS website to get the money from your linked account, then this will appear as a direct debit, and takes a bit longer than a faster payment.

    If you go onto the website of your linked account and send money to newcastle (remember the reference needs to identify your newcastle account), then that's a faster payment.
